动态Fiori瓷砖信息

2020-09-02 04:28发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


我无法在Fiori磁贴中显示动态信息。 我找到了几个博客,讨论如何与磁贴共享动态信息,但是它没有用(尽管从所有方面来看都应该如此)。

  • 我创建了一个非常简单的HDB Calculation View,并(出于测试目的)用正确的名称硬编码了多个值
  • 我将计算视图公开为OData API

此处显示OData响应:

我的第一个问题是:以上元素的名称正确吗? 我在此处。 不幸的是,该图块无法反映我已硬编码的值("数字"值除外,该值似乎确实起作用)。

任何帮助将不胜感激!

(82.8 kB)

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


我无法在Fiori磁贴中显示动态信息。 我找到了几个博客,讨论如何与磁贴共享动态信息,但是它没有用(尽管从所有方面来看都应该如此)。

  • 我创建了一个非常简单的HDB Calculation View,并(出于测试目的)用正确的名称硬编码了多个值
  • 我将计算视图公开为OData API

此处显示OData响应:

我的第一个问题是:以上元素的名称正确吗? 我在此处。 不幸的是,该图块无法反映我已硬编码的值("数字"值除外,该值似乎确实起作用)。

任何帮助将不胜感激!

(82.8 kB)
付费偷看设置
发送
3条回答
黑丝骑士
1楼 · 2020-09-02 05:09.采纳回答

我认为问题是由您请求实体集(结果数组)而不是实体引起的。 HANA开发指南中包含以下示例

 {
   " d":{
     " icon":" sap-icon://travel-expense",
     " info":"季度结束!",
     " infoState":"严重",
     " number":" 43333.34000",
     " numberDigits":2,
     " numberFactor":" k",
     " numberState":"正",
     " numberUnit":" EUR",
     " stateArrow":"向上",
     "字幕":"季度概览",
     标题:"旅费"
   }
 }
 

我关注了博客文章为SAP BPC创建动态应用启动器Fiori Tile ,以便在我的ABAP系统上重新创建它,并获得以下动态瓦片:

Cikesha
2楼-- · 2020-09-02 05:16

再次问好,格雷戈尔。 我最终要做的是用一个密钥调用OData服务,这样我将得到一个单一的实体,而不是一个集合。 我在"计算视图"中添加了一个"计算列",名称为" ID",常量值为" 1"。 完成该操作并使用键" 1"进行调用后,我又得到了一个实体,因此所有的值都可以正确反映。 再次非常感谢您的帮助,这让我走上了正确的路!

CJones
3楼-- · 2020-09-02 04:59

我正面临着同样的问题。 创建动态磁贴时,只有数字会反映在磁贴上。

其他人没有反映。

我的oData响应- tile.jpg odata-response.jpg

请帮助我。

谢谢

Navneet

一周热门 更多>